P277 Full Waveform Inversion of Shot Gathers in Terms of Poro–Elastic Parameters L. de Barros (Université Joseph Fourier) & M. Dietrich* (Institut Français du Pétrole) SUMMARY We have developed a full waveform iterative inversion procedure for determining the porosity permeability interstitial fluid properties and mechanical parameters of stratified porous media. The inverse problem is solved by using a generalized least-squares formalism. The proposed method achieves computational efficiency through semi-analytical semi-numerical solutions for calculating the reference and perturbation wave fields from Biot’s theory.
